So you cannot got to the Middle East without visiting the souq. It's a local market filled with Arabian restaurants, shops and stalls. My favourite souq in Doha is Souq Waqif. I know all the stores there and already made good friendships with some of the store owners. When buying something you are encouraged to barter with the shop owner and get discounts on your purchases. I feel like I have perfected the art of bartering at the souq and never buy anything full price. This time I bought more scarves for my family and delectable Arabic baklava (sweet desserts) to take home.

I went on another boat road in the Doha Bay area too. I love these boat rides at night as you get to see the skyscrapers light up like Christmas trees. The view is very beautiful and sailing on the water is exciting. The weather is a little cooler at night as well, so the warm sea breeze is quite enjoyable.
